Long hours in the tractor can make farming physically demanding. Operators must maintain a steady path, watch the implement, and respond to changing field conditions at the same time. Over many passes, small steering errors can also affect the consistency of fieldwork. An auto steering system for tractor can help address some of these challenges by assisting with machine direction and reducing the need for constant manual corrections. Manual steering requires continuous attention, especially during long planting, spraying, or cultivation operations. Even experienced operators may become tired after several hours of repetitive work. Automated steering can reduce the amount of constant steering input required, allowing operators to focus more on the implement, field conditions, and surrounding environment. This can make long working sessions less demanding. However, operators still need to monitor the machine and remain ready to take control when necessary. The goal is to support the operator, not remove human oversight.
Repeated passes are common in modern agriculture. If the tractor moves too far from the planned route, overlaps or missed areas may occur. This can affect the use of seeds, fertilizer, or crop protection products. An auto steering system for tractor can help maintain more consistent paths during repetitive operations. This is especially useful when working across large fields where small deviations can accumulate over many passes. Farmers should still consider field shape, positioning conditions, and equipment setup, as these factors can influence the final performance.
